    SPR Build (Pics and Info)

    I just completed my SPR build this week. I was waiting on a couple of small parts to completely finish it up (AAC 51T Brake and custom 3-position gas block) even though I'd assembled it months ago and even shot it a couple times.

    Here's the details:

    Upper

    Mega Machine Billet Upper Receiver
    PRI Gas Buster C/H
    Fail Zero Bolt Carrier
    Superior Barrels 18" Terebraetus Barrel (1/8 twist, polygonally rifled, hard blue coated inside and out)
    MP bolt from Superior pre-headspaced to barrel
    JP/VTAC Rifle Length FF Tube
    Custom 3-position gas block (On/Suppressed/Off)
    AAC 51-tooth Muzzle Brake

    Lower
    Mega Machine Billet Lower
    M&A Lower Parts Kit
    Geissele High Speed DMR Trigger
    Magpul MIAD Grip
    Magpul ASAP Plate
    Magpul ACS Stock

    Optic/Sights/Light
    Trijicon TA31H-G (Green Illumination)
    Magpul MBUS Front and Rear
    Fenix TA20 with Pressure Switch Tailcap (they unfortunately only make the long curly cord ones right now)
    VLTOR Offset Scout Mount (puts light at 1 o'clock position when placed on the 3 o'clock rail)
    Tango Down Switch Rail Panel (on top rail for ease of use shooting bilaterally)

    Here are some photos of it:






    I shot a 10-shot group at 100 yards with it yesterday (just for grins). I didn't let the barrel cool between shots and fired each shot about 3-4 seconds after the previous one. I was shooting Lake City 62gr Green Tip because I wanted to see what the rifle was capable of with surplus ammo. I shot this without the can on the rifle. I plan on shooting another group with it to see if it tightens up any.

    I went with the JP/VTAC tube over a quad rail becuase I don't mount a whole lot on the front of my rifles. I'm not a VFG guy and don't have the desire to hang a bunch of tacticool gizmos on my stick. I am all about a light - which the JP/VTAC tube easily allows me to mount - but that's about it. Not to mention the only quad rail close in weight was considerably more $. And then when you add rail covers it gets even heavier.

    I would ultimately like to have the light at 12:00 but with the setup I've got it just didn't work for me. Instead it's at 1:00 and my front sight is all the way out on the rail so I've got the longest sight radius possible. Behind the front sight is a rail panel with switch cutout so that I can work the light with my thumb of my forward hand regardless of when I'm shooting right or left handed.

    The only reason I didn't go with the VTAC Extreme is because I didn't know it existed until now.
